Dan Benishek Defeats Jerry Cannon In Michigan Midterm Election

Rep. Dan Benishek (R-Mich.) won a third term in Congress in Tuesday's midterm election.

Benishek defeated Democrat Jerry Cannon. He was first elected to represent Michigan's 1st District in 2010.

Cannon is a retired general and former sheriff of Kalkaska County, Michigan, who was the commander of the Joint Detention Operations Group at Guantanamo Bay, according to The Leader.
